📝 Translation of file-object.md to pt-br [ci skip]
This commit is contained in:
parent
9c53d241fa
commit
2714f280f5
2 changed files with 32 additions and 1 deletions
|
@ -40,7 +40,7 @@ Existem muitas perguntas comuns que são feitas, verifique antes de criar uma is
|
|||
|
||||
### Elementos DOM Personalizados:
|
||||
|
||||
* [Objeto `File`](../../docs/api/file-object.md)
|
||||
* [Objeto `File`](../../docs-translations/pt-BR/api/file-object.md)
|
||||
* [Tag `<webview>`](../../docs/api/web-view-tag.md)
|
||||
* [Função `window.open`](../../docs/api/window-open.md)
|
||||
|
||||
|
|
31
docs-translations/pt-BR/api/file-object.md
Normal file
31
docs-translations/pt-BR/api/file-object.md
Normal file
|
@ -0,0 +1,31 @@
|
|||
# `File` Object
|
||||
|
||||
> Use a API `File` do HTML5 para funcionar nativamente com os arquivos do sistema.
|
||||
|
||||
|
||||
A interface dos arquivos DOM promovem uma abstração dos arquivos nativos, permitindo que os usuários trabalhem em arquivos nativos diretamente com a API file do HTML5. O Electron adicionou um atributo `path` à interface `File` que exibe o caminho do arquivo no sistema.
|
||||
|
||||
Exemplo de como obter o caminho de um arquivo arrastado para a aplicação:
|
||||
|
||||
```html
|
||||
<div id="holder">
|
||||
Arraste e solte seu arquivo aqui
|
||||
</div>
|
||||
|
||||
<script>
|
||||
const holder = document.getElementById('holder')
|
||||
holder.ondragover = () => {
|
||||
return false;
|
||||
}
|
||||
holder.ondragleave = holder.ondragend = () => {
|
||||
return false;
|
||||
}
|
||||
holder.ondrop = (e) => {
|
||||
e.preventDefault()
|
||||
for (let f of e.dataTransfer.files) {
|
||||
console.log('Arquivo(s) arrastados: ', f.path)
|
||||
}
|
||||
return false;
|
||||
}
|
||||
</script>
|
||||
```
|
Loading…
Add table
Reference in a new issue